This indulgent stout offers bold toasted coconut flavors that shine through both in the aroma and taste, complemented by smooth chocolate notes and the deep, rich roast of Vietnamese coffee. The result is a smooth, slightly sweet beer with a satisfying roastiness and a well-rounded balance of flavors that make every sip indulgent.

Poured from a can dated August 11, 2025.
Aroma is coffee forward with lighter toasted coconut notes. Moderately strong chocolate notes with some dark caramel and toffee notes. Lighter roast notes with some burnt sugar and a touch of green peppers. Medium light alcohol notes.
Pours jet black with a medium sized, thick, creamy, mocha head that recedes slowly to a small film that lingers. Moderately large amount of lacing and long legs.
Flavor is moderately sweet with lots of chocolate, brown sugar, toffee and caramel. Lighter roast notes. Moderately strong bitterness and medium low alcohol warmth. Moderate toasted coconut notes that longer a bit stronger in the finish. Light oiliness from the coconut. Moderate coffee notes.
Mouthfeel is full bodied with medium low carbonation. Low, but present astringency and medium low alcohol warmth.
Overall, a solid coffee stout with lots of toasted coconut notes. A bit more bitter than I was hoping for, but otherwise it's really nice. A touch of oil from the coconut. The coconut and coffee notes are really nice.
